C86500 Bronze vs. AWS BAu-3

C86500 bronze belongs to the copper alloys classification, while AWS BAu-3 belongs to the otherwise unclassified metals. They have 58% of their average alloy composition in common. There are 15 material properties with values for both materials. Properties with values for just one material (14, in this case) are not shown.

For each property being compared, the top bar is C86500 bronze and the bottom bar is AWS BAu-3.
